The e & ICE Powertrain Program Manager (PM) is responsible for future and carryover e & ICE Powertrain related programs from a Supplier Quality (SQ) perspective. They will focus on e & ICE Powertrain programs.
The e & ICE Powertrain PM is responsible for ensuring key quality milestones/goals are met for all supplier components involved in the assigned programs. This individual will also work cross functionally with Engineering, Manufacturing, Supply Chain, Purchasing and Plant SQ, through the full life cycle of components from early development, sourcing, launch phase and into production.
A Program Manager needs to be able to develop, present, and explain program status updates to senior leadership.
The following responsibilities apply to a Program Manager:
Track and provide status updates on Supplier Quality activities for designated programs
Analyze and track Key Activity Indicators (KAIs),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), Propulsion System KPIs (PSKs), and other related key supplier operational metrics for Stellantis and make recommendations and/or escalate issues as appropriate
The Program Managers will facilitate Supplier Quality Engineers (SQE) follow-up and closure of issues identified at a Powertrain facility during the launch phase
Manage program reporting requirements for program reviews
Work with internal stakeholders in the early stages of the concept phase to gain understanding of supplier risk issues on future program development with a concept phase proactive focus
Provide objective recommendations to the supplier pre-selection and sourcing decisions
Facilitate safe launch strategies and problem resolution reviews
Support the achievement of development and execution phase deliverables to assure flawless launch results and supplier readiness
